A reminder: The body is an adaptive organism and is never stagnant. It is adapting according to the information is is given. If the body is out of balance it will adapt accordingly and often with a less than desirable, longterm outcome. If, however, we begin to supply new information in the form of exercises that request for better equilibrium in terms of alignment, strength, and tension then the adaptation will follow that course of action. But consistency is the magic piece to keep the body progressing toward optimal health.
